COVID-19 PATIENT WHO ESCAPED FROM ISOLATION CENTRE RETURNS, SURRENDERS FAMILY MEMBERS

A COVID-19 patient who fled after he tested positive for coronavirus has returned and surrendered himself alongside his family members to the COVID-19 treatment facility in Aba. 


This was contained in a statement signed and issued by the State Commissioner for Information, Okeiyi Kalu on Saturday, May 30.


The patient, name withheld, fled from the Infectious Disease Hospital (IDH) on Thursday, May 28 having heard that he tested positive for coronavirus. 



Kalu said the patient returned to the facility early in the morning of Saturday with his wife and other family members. 


He added that the patient and his family members were taken to the State Specialist Hospital and Diagnostic centre where they will be tested for Coronavirus. 


According to Kalu, the Rapid Response Team has started contact tracing in case the escaped patient had had contact with anyone.

He added that the contact tracing will avert any form of community transmission of the disease. 


Kalu stated that three patients currently receiving treatment at the isolation centre would be discharged on Saturday as they have tested negative twice to COVID-19.
